THE UK’s biggest electricity network is up for sale after its owner confirmed today it was looking at "ownership options" for the business.

EDF Energy operates 100,000 miles of electrical network across London, the South East and eastern England, connecting to eight million homes.

French power giant EDF, which bought British Energy for more than £12 billion last year, is examining a possible sale as part of plans to cut five billion euros (£4.6 billion) from its debts by the end of 2010.
